Title: My home made quiver.
Post by: huntnut on August 02, 2007, 10:16:00 AM
Well it's not pretty but it works. It's made out of a 4" drainage pipe thats 24" long, I steched a peice of leather into the bottom of it with a peice of 3" foam for broadheads. Just a 2" wide leather strape. I put a peice of mylar inside of it so my arrows can slide out easyer then with the corigattion lets it. And it weighs next to nothing. I'm right now looking for a pelt to put on it, I'm looking for a red fox for my first pick, maybe a coon or badger, so if anyone mite have a pelt for cheap that has been tanned let me know. I will post more pics when its all done. I forgot to add that this cost me $0.00 to builb so far, the pelt is the only thing that well cost me. I have a deer hide w/hair on but I don't feel safe having a deer hair quiver and hunting on public ground. To many idiots in the woods now days.
